First of all, what year are you refering to? You can look up OPGI (only bad thing is you'll have to pay taxes since you live in Cali, but shipping is free this month). Also check out the following links:
http://www.thepartsplaceinc.com/
http://www.usapartssupply.com/
http://www.fusick.com/
http://www.kanter.com/
This should get you started.

opgi has some stuff too. There is also BAP, but I heard some bad things about them. Most of these places have online catalogues you can DL to your comp. I printed out a bunch of them and put the pages in 3 ring binders for easy reference. Cant go wrong with a 69 W30
